summ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orabs <abs>1999-08-13 21:24:11 +0000
committerabs <abs>1999-08-13 21:24:11 +0000
commitc0515425062d19890b7e7e45db2305c2cf864d7d (patch)
tree8147dc46c401add89f1e8c1566997790024497a3
parent58e92916a22cf2225ec71353c9e6163251258d3b (diff)
downloadpkgsrc-c0515425062d19890b7e7e45db2305c2cf864d7d.tar.gz
Make this work under solaris-sparc
-rw-r--r--www/communicator/Makefile19
-rw-r--r--www/communicator/files/md53
-rw-r--r--www/communicator/pkg/PLIST.alpha2
-rw-r--r--www/communicator/pkg/PLIST.netbsd-alpha2
-rw-r--r--www/communicator/pkg/PLIST.netbsd-i386 (renamed from www/communicator/pkg/PLIST.i386)2
-rw-r--r--www/communicator/pkg/PLIST.netbsd-sparc (renamed from www/communicator/pkg/PLIST.sparc)2
-rw-r--r--www/communicator/pkg/PLIST.solaris-sparc7
-rw-r--r--www/navigator/Makefile18
-rw-r--r--www/navigator/files/md53
-rw-r--r--www/navigator/pkg/PLIST.alpha2
-rw-r--r--www/navigator/pkg/PLIST.netbsd-alpha2
-rw-r--r--www/navigator/pkg/PLIST.netbsd-i386 (renamed from www/navigator/pkg/PLIST.i386)2
-rw-r--r--www/navigator/pkg/PLIST.netbsd-sparc (renamed from www/navigator/pkg/PLIST.sparc)2
-rw-r--r--www/navigator/pkg/PLIST.solaris-sparc7
14 files changed, 51 insertions, 22 deletions
diff --git a/www/communicator/Makefile b/www/communicator/Makefile
index 68e5cdfd36f..ce117bd7b47 100644
--- a/www/communicator/Makefile
+++ b/www/communicator/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.17 1999/07/12 00:06:57 jlam Exp $
+# $NetBSD: Makefile,v 1.18 1999/08/13 21:24:12 abs Exp $
#
# Every effort has been made to keep the communicator and navigator
# Makefiles as similar as possible.
@@ -8,7 +8,12 @@ NS_VERS= 4.61
NS_VERS_SHORT= 461
NS_ENCRYPTION?= export
#
-.if (${MACHINE_ARCH} == "alpha")
+.include "../../mk/bsd.prefs.mk"
+.if ${OPSYS} == "SunOS" && ${MACHINE_ARCH} == "sparc"
+DISTUNAME= sparc-sun-solaris2.5.1
+DIST_DIR_NAME= supported/sunos551
+WRKNAME= sparc-sun-solaris2.5.1
+.elif (${MACHINE_ARCH} == "alpha")
.if !exists(/emul/osf1/sbin/loader)
IGNORE= requires Digital UNIX libraries - see compat_osf1(8)
.endif
@@ -17,7 +22,7 @@ DIST_DIR_NAME= supported/dec_unix40
WRKNAME= alpha-dec-osf4.0
.elif (${MACHINE_ARCH} == "i386")
.if !exists(/emul/linux/lib/ld-linux.so.2)
-IGNORE= requires Linux libraries - see compat_linux(8)
+IGNORE= requires Linux glibc2 libraries - see compat_linux(8)
.endif
DISTUNAME= x86-unknown-linuxglibc2.0
DIST_DIR_NAME= supported/linux20_glibc2
@@ -85,10 +90,12 @@ do-install:
${SED} -e 's#@@MOZILLA_HOME@@#${MOZILLA_HOME}#g' \
<${FILESDIR}/${BINNAME}.sh >${WRKDIR}/${BINNAME}.sh
${INSTALL_SCRIPT} ${WRKDIR}/${BINNAME}.sh ${PREFIX}/bin/${PKGNAME}
+ ${RM} -f ${PREFIX}/bin/${BINNAME}
${LN} -sf ${PKGNAME} ${PREFIX}/bin/${BINNAME}
+ ${RM} -f ${PREFIX}/bin/netscape
${LN} -sf ${PKGNAME} ${PREFIX}/bin/netscape
-.if (${MACHINE_ARCH} == "sparc")
+.if ${OPSYS} == "NetBSD" && ${MACHINE_ARCH} == "sparc"
# Bizarre magic to handle the NIS and DNS versions. Make DNS default.
@${SED} -e 's#MOZILLA_HOME/netscape#MOZILLA_HOME/netscape_nis#g' \
<${WRKDIR}/${BINNAME}.sh >${WRKDIR}/${BINNAME}_nis.sh
@@ -99,8 +106,8 @@ do-install:
${MV} ${MOZILLA_HOME}/netscape_dns ${MOZILLA_HOME}/netscape
.endif
- ${SED} -e ${NS_PLIST_SED} ${PKGDIR}/PLIST.${MACHINE_ARCH} \
- >>${PLIST_SRC}
+ ${SED} -e ${NS_PLIST_SED} \
+ ${PKGDIR}/PLIST.${LOWER_OPSYS}-${MACHINE_ARCH} >>${PLIST_SRC}
${CHOWN} -R 0:0 ${MOZILLA_HOME}
${CHMOD} -R go-w ${MOZILLA_HOME}
diff --git a/www/communicator/files/md5 b/www/communicator/files/md5
index e6d41bfa25d..27b65d54b18 100644
--- a/www/communicator/files/md5
+++ b/www/communicator/files/md5
@@ -1,6 +1,7 @@
-$NetBSD: md5,v 1.7 1999/06/21 08:44:29 jlam Exp $
+$NetBSD: md5,v 1.8 1999/08/13 21:24:12 abs Exp $
MD5 (communicator-v461-export.alpha-dec-osf4.0.tar.gz) = b431d2de9d6340779f8bc82e7a5ceb82
+MD5 (communicator-v461-export.sparc-sun-solaris2.5.1.tar.gz) = da9ccf8189d7cd4ab0960c944c2179b6
MD5 (communicator-v461-export.sparc-sun-sunos4.1.3_U1.tar.gz) = 26d2944a58d6fa8c73ff5a4a2f3d7258
MD5 (communicator-v461-export.x86-unknown-linuxglibc2.0.tar.gz) = 2716a95847687cdb1cda0a52c0cbb1ff
MD5 (communicator-v461-us.alpha-dec-osf4.0.tar.gz) = af72f7a77ee590ab550a1623f0879c99
diff --git a/www/communicator/pkg/PLIST.alpha b/www/communicator/pkg/PLIST.alpha
deleted file mode 100644
index 98a87855856..00000000000
--- a/www/communicator/pkg/PLIST.alpha
+++ /dev/null
@@ -1,2 +0,0 @@
-@comment $NetBSD: PLIST.alpha,v 1.1 1999/06/14 21:43:35 cgd Exp $
-lib/netscape/communicator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/communicator/pkg/PLIST.netbsd-alpha b/www/communicator/pkg/PLIST.netbsd-alpha
new file mode 100644
index 00000000000..8a8bc2cd1b9
--- /dev/null
+++ b/www/communicator/pkg/PLIST.netbsd-alpha
@@ -0,0 +1,2 @@
+@comment $NetBSD: PLIST.netbsd-alpha,v 1.1 1999/08/13 21:24:13 abs Exp $
+lib/netscape/communicator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/communicator/pkg/PLIST.i386 b/www/communicator/pkg/PLIST.netbsd-i386
index f6967be0805..cb5cc98b73b 100644
--- a/www/communicator/pkg/PLIST.i386
+++ b/www/communicator/pkg/PLIST.netbsd-i386
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ST.i386,v 1.2 1999/06/14 21:40:25 cgd Exp $
+@comment $NetBSD: PLIST.netbsd-i386,v 1.1 1999/08/13 21:24:13 abs Exp $
lib/netscape/communicator-${NS_VERS}/libjsd.so
lib/netscape/communicator-${NS_VERS}/dynfonts/libTrueDoc.so
lib/netscape/communicator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/communicator/pkg/PLIST.sparc b/www/communicator/pkg/PLIST.netbsd-sparc
index e08359ab882..36362474e3b 100644
--- a/www/communicator/pkg/PLIST.sparc
+++ b/www/communicator/pkg/PLIST.netbsd-sparc
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ST.sparc,v 1.5 1999/06/14 21:40:25 cgd Exp $
+@comment $NetBSD: PLIST.netbsd-sparc,v 1.1 1999/08/13 21:24:13 abs Exp $
bin/communicator-${NS_VERS}_nis
bin/netscape_nis
lib/netscape/communicator-${NS_VERS}/netscape_nis
diff --git a/www/communicator/pkg/PLIST.solaris-sparc b/www/communicator/pkg/PLIST.solaris-sparc
new file mode 100644
index 00000000000..fa1d732a073
--- /dev/null
+++ b/www/communicator/pkg/PLIST.solaris-sparc
@@ -0,0 +1,7 @@
+@comment $NetBSD: PLIST.solaris-sparc,v 1.1 1999/08/13 21:24:13 abs Exp $
+lib/netscape/communicator-${NS_VERS}/dynfonts/libTrueDoc.so
+lib/netscape/communicator-${NS_VERS}/plugins/libnullplugin.so
+lib/netscape/communicator-${NS_VERS}/talkback/master.ini
+@dirrm lib/netscape/communicator-${NS_VERS}/dynfonts
+@dirrm lib/netscape/communicator-${NS_VERS}/talkback
+
diff --git a/www/navigator/Makefile b/www/navigator/Makefile
index 4767d2eb751..1522c3696f5 100644
--- a/www/navigator/Makefile
+++ b/www/navigator/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.16 1999/07/12 00:06:58 jlam Exp $
+# $NetBSD: Makefile,v 1.17 1999/08/13 21:24:11 abs Exp $
#
# Every effort has been made to keep the communicator and navigator
# Makefiles as similar as possible.
@@ -8,7 +8,12 @@ NS_VERS= 4.61
NS_VERS_SHORT= 461
NS_ENCRYPTION?= export
#
-.if (${MACHINE_ARCH} == "alpha")
+.include "../../mk/bsd.prefs.mk"
+.if ${OPSYS} == "SunOS" && ${MACHINE_ARCH} == "sparc"
+DISTUNAME= sparc-sun-solaris2.5.1
+DIST_DIR_NAME= supported/sunos551
+WRKNAME= sparc-sun-solaris2.5.1
+.elif (${MACHINE_ARCH} == "alpha")
.if !exists(/emul/osf1/sbin/loader)
IGNORE= requires Digital UNIX libraries - see compat_osf1(8)
.endif
@@ -17,7 +22,7 @@ DIST_DIR_NAME= supported/dec_unix40
WRKNAME= alpha-dec-osf4.0
.elif (${MACHINE_ARCH} == "i386")
.if !exists(/emul/linux/lib/ld-linux.so.2)
-IGNORE= requires Linux glibc2 libraries - see compat_linux(8).
+IGNORE= requires Linux glibc2 libraries - see compat_linux(8)
.endif
DISTUNAME= x86-unknown-linuxglibc2.0
DIST_DIR_NAME= supported/linux20_glibc2
@@ -84,9 +89,10 @@ do-install:
${SED} -e 's#@@MOZILLA_HOME@@#${MOZILLA_HOME}#g' \
<${FILESDIR}/${BINNAME}.sh >${WRKDIR}/${BINNAME}.sh
${INSTALL_SCRIPT} ${WRKDIR}/${BINNAME}.sh ${PREFIX}/bin/${PKGNAME}
+ ${RM} -f ${PREFIX}/bin/${BINNAME}
${LN} -sf ${PKGNAME} ${PREFIX}/bin/${BINNAME}
-.if (${MACHINE_ARCH} == "sparc")
+.if ${OPSYS} == "NetBSD" && ${MACHINE_ARCH} == "sparc"
# Bizarre magic to handle the NIS and DNS versions. Make DNS default.
@${SED} -e 's#MOZILLA_HOME/netscape#MOZILLA_HOME/netscape_nis#g' \
<${WRKDIR}/${BINNAME}.sh >${WRKDIR}/${BINNAME}_nis.sh
@@ -96,8 +102,8 @@ do-install:
${MV} ${MOZILLA_HOME}/netscape_dns ${MOZILLA_HOME}/netscape
.endif
- ${SED} -e ${NS_PLIST_SED} ${PKGDIR}/PLIST.${MACHINE_ARCH} \
- >>${PLIST_SRC}
+ ${SED} -e ${NS_PLIST_SED} \
+ ${PKGDIR}/PLIST.${LOWER_OPSYS}-${MACHINE_ARCH} >>${PLIST_SRC}
${CHOWN} -R 0:0 ${MOZILLA_HOME}
${CHMOD} -R go-w ${MOZILLA_HOME}
diff --git a/www/navigator/files/md5 b/www/navigator/files/md5
index e07699547f8..6d00e13cab9 100644
--- a/www/navigator/files/md5
+++ b/www/navigator/files/md5
@@ -1,6 +1,7 @@
-$NetBSD: md5,v 1.7 1999/06/21 08:45:05 jlam Exp $
+$NetBSD: md5,v 1.8 1999/08/13 21:24:11 abs Exp $
MD5 (navigator-v461-export.alpha-dec-osf4.0.tar.gz) = c044e2d82b043254de019875ca0ce91d
+MD5 (navigator-v461-export.sparc-sun-solaris2.5.1.tar.gz) = 14405703ab2c25354b77516eef52fe21
MD5 (navigator-v461-export.sparc-sun-sunos4.1.3_U1.tar.gz) = a1bc10d5dfce9f36ddae55930d683b6d
MD5 (navigator-v461-export.x86-unknown-linuxglibc2.0.tar.gz) = 420a7618848a884e7b408a80fe283b80
MD5 (navigator-v461-us.alpha-dec-osf4.0.tar.gz) = 043592386899a96a94c3530c32488660
diff --git a/www/navigator/pkg/PLIST.alpha b/www/navigator/pkg/PLIST.alpha
deleted file mode 100644
index 53b448cf3e7..00000000000
--- a/www/navigator/pkg/PLIST.alpha
+++ /dev/null
@@ -1,2 +0,0 @@
-@comment $NetBSD: PLIST.alpha,v 1.1 1999/06/14 21:43:39 cgd Exp $
-lib/netscape/navigator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/navigator/pkg/PLIST.netbsd-alpha b/www/navigator/pkg/PLIST.netbsd-alpha
new file mode 100644
index 00000000000..a17ee1e6b25
--- /dev/null
+++ b/www/navigator/pkg/PLIST.netbsd-alpha
@@ -0,0 +1,2 @@
+@comment $NetBSD: PLIST.netbsd-alpha,v 1.1 1999/08/13 21:24:12 abs Exp $
+lib/netscape/navigator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/navigator/pkg/PLIST.i386 b/www/navigator/pkg/PLIST.netbsd-i386
index 5a11c4e389e..cfb744547b7 100644
--- a/www/navigator/pkg/PLIST.i386
+++ b/www/navigator/pkg/PLIST.netbsd-i386
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ST.i386,v 1.2 1999/06/14 21:40:05 cgd Exp $
+@comment $NetBSD: PLIST.netbsd-i386,v 1.1 1999/08/13 21:24:12 abs Exp $
lib/netscape/navigator-${NS_VERS}/dynfonts/libTrueDoc.so
lib/netscape/navigator-${NS_VERS}/plugins/libnullplugin.so
lib/netscape/navigator-${NS_VERS}/netscape-dynMotif
diff --git a/www/navigator/pkg/PLIST.sparc b/www/navigator/pkg/PLIST.netbsd-sparc
index 1fb9ea1325a..79c3de0a35c 100644
--- a/www/navigator/pkg/PLIST.sparc
+++ b/www/navigator/pkg/PLIST.netbsd-sparc
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ST.sparc,v 1.5 1999/06/14 21:40:05 cgd Exp $
+@comment $NetBSD: PLIST.netbsd-sparc,v 1.1 1999/08/13 21:24:12 abs Exp $
lib/netscape/navigator-${NS_VERS}/netscape_nis
lib/netscape/navigator-${NS_VERS}/dynfonts/libTrueDoc.so
lib/netscape/navigator-${NS_VERS}/plugins/libnullplugin.so
diff --git a/www/navigator/pkg/PLIST.solaris-sparc b/www/navigator/pkg/PLIST.solaris-sparc
new file mode 100644
index 00000000000..90efc3dba0a
--- /dev/null
+++ b/www/navigator/pkg/PLIST.solaris-sparc
@@ -0,0 +1,7 @@
+@comment $NetBSD: PLIST.solaris-sparc,v 1.1 1999/08/13 21:24:12 abs Exp $
+lib/netscape/navigator-${NS_VERS}/dynfonts/libTrueDoc.so
+lib/netscape/navigator-${NS_VERS}/plugins/libnullplugin.so
+lib/netscape/navigator-${NS_VERS}/talkback/master.ini
+@dirrm lib/netscape/navigator-${NS_VERS}/dynfonts
+@dirrm lib/netscape/navigator-${NS_VERS}/talkback
+